Types of Insurance Claims

Before we delve into the steps of filing an insurance claim, it’s essential to understand the different types of insurance claims. There are two main types of insurance claims: property damage and personal injury. Property damage claims involve damages to your property, such as a car accident or damage to your home due to natural disasters. Personal injury claims involve injuries you sustained due to someone else’s negligence, such as a slip and fall or a car accident.

What to Do Before Filing an Insurance Claim

Before filing an insurance claim, there are a few things you should do to prepare:

  1. Document the damages or injuries by taking pictures or videos. This will help provide evidence of the damages or injuries.
  2. Report the incident to the police or relevant authorities. This is especially important for personal injury claims.
  3. Review your insurance policy to understand the coverage and deductibles.

How to File an Insurance Claim

Once you have prepared the necessary documentation, you must file the insurance claim. The process varies depending on the type of insurance claim, but the general steps are as follows:

Step 1: Contact Your Insurance Company

Contact your insurance company immediately to report the incident and begin the claims process. Your insurance company will provide the necessary forms and information to complete the claim.

Step 2: Fill out the Claim Forms

Fill out the claim forms carefully, providing all necessary information, such as the date and location of the incident, the damages or injuries sustained, and any witnesses.

Step 3: Provide Supporting Documentation

Attach any supporting documentation, such as pictures or videos of the damages or injuries, police reports, and medical bills.

Step 4: Wait for an Adjuster to Contact You

After submitting the claim, an adjuster will contact you to review the claim and assess the damages or injuries. They may need to inspect the damages or injuries in person.

Step 5: Receive Payment

If the claim is approved, the insurance company will pay you for the damages or injuries. If the claim is denied, the insurance company will explain why.

What to Do If Your Claim Is Denied

If your insurance claim is denied, don’t panic. You have options. First, review your insurance policy and the reason for the denial. You can appeal the decision if you believe the denial was made in error. You can also seek legal advice if necessary.

How long does it take to receive payment for an insurance claim?

The time it takes to receive payment for an insurance claim varies depending on the type of claim, the insurance company, and the circumstances of the incident. Generally, receiving payment can take anywhere from a few days to a few weeks.
